I am trying to find information about my Irish roots, without much luck. I decend from William McClure, 1806-1857, who married Sarah McAlwein (not sure on the surname of spelling as it is hard to read on certificates). His son David (married to Margaret Ross) migrated to Australia, 1840-1897, as well as two daughters, Sarah (married Robert Learmonth) and Isabella (married Thomas Malcolm). While Mary Anne (married William Porter), William (married to Isabella ?) and Elizabeth (married George Baldrick) stayed in Donegal. His brother was the Reverend Francis McClure. Other immediate family and nieces and nephews migrated to Indiana in the USA.

Any help would be appreciated!

  • Hi Emily

    There is a baptism record of William McClure 1807 Donegal on www.rootsireland.ie/

    The record, which costs to view will have the parish and MAYBE his parents' names.

    There is also a record of the marriage of William McClure to Sarah McIlwaine 1830 in Donegal.
